How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Santa Rosa Beach?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Cheap Santa Rosa Beach Studio Apartments | $1,947 | $1,490 | $3,211 |
| Cheap Santa Rosa Beach 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,781 | $1,262 | $10,000+ |
| Cheap Santa Rosa Beach 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,219 | $1,377 | $5,008 |
| Cheap Santa Rosa Beach 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,657 | $1,721 | $9,882 |
| Cheap Santa Rosa Beach 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,811 | $2,461 | $10,000+ |

Cheapest Available Santa Rosa Beach Apartments for Rent
 The cheapest available apartment rental in Santa Rosa Beach, FL is a 2 Beds unit found at Rosemary Place priced from $521. Terra Mar has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$1,262. Here is today’s list of the most affordable Santa Rosa Beach apartments for rent: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Rosemary Place | 2 Bdrm | 2BR,2BA | $521 |
| Terra Mar | Cyprus | 1BR,1BA | $1,262 |
| Parkside at the Beach | A1 Den | 1BR,1BA | $1,287 |
| White Sands | The Cabana | 1BR,1BA | $1,330 |
| Sunnyside Apartments | 1B1BS 120 | 1BR,1BA | $1,360 |
| Solis at Niceville | 2x1 Reno | 2BR,1BA | $1,377 |
| Infinity Hammock Bay | Nova | 1BR,1BA | $1,394 |
| The Tyde Apartments | A1 | 1BR,1BA | $1,399 |
| Legends at Clara | The St. George | 1BR,1BA | $1,399 |
| Seaview Apartments at Santa Rosa Beach | The Reef | 1BR,1BA | $1,400 |
